The Top 10 Popular Travel Apps: Exploring the Future of Travel


travel 1

Traveling has become more accessible and convenient than ever before, thanks to the fact that there are a ton of applications at our disposal. From booking flights to locating the top restaurants in the area, these software programs have made planning and experiencing a trip more effortless and enjoyable. Here are the top 10 popular travel apps, along with their functionality, pros/cons, and alternatives.

Airbnb

  • Functionality: Airbnb is a website connecting tourists with local hosts and providing unique accommodations worldwide. Customers of the app may look for houses and flats, or experiences in their desired location, book a stay, and communicate with the host.
  • Pros: Airbnb offers affordable and authentic accommodations, personalized experiences, and a chance to connect with locals. It gives an intuitive interface for users and a safe means of payment.
  • Cons: Some properties may not match their descriptions, and communication with the host can be unreliable. Additionally, some cities and countries have strict regulations or limitations on short rentals and restrictions on the availability of options.
  • Alternatives: Vrbo, Booking.com, Homestay, Couchsurfing.

Booking.com

  • Functionality: It is a booking application providing various types of accommodations, from hotels to apartments and vacation rentals. This software allows a consumer to search for or book a stay and receive real-time updates and alerts. 
  • Pros: It provides a vast collection of properties at very competitive prices, with zero registering fees. It also provides detailed property info, user reviews, maps, and more. 
  • Cons: Cancellation policies are complex and strict, and some property charge hidden fees as well. Also, one can get overwhelmed with a lot of filtering choices and pop-up messages. 
  • Alternatives: Expedia, Hotels.com, Kayak, Agoda. 
  • TripAdvisor

    • Functionality: TripAdvisor is a travel planner that allows users to browse millions of reviews and recommendations for hotels, restaurants, and attractions worldwide. It also offers a flight search and booking tool.
    • Pros: TripAdvisor provides authentic and helpful reviews and ratings, as well as detailed destination guides. It gives a “Near Me Now” feature for discovering nearby places of interest.
    • Cons: The app can be slow and glitchy, and some reviews may be biased or inaccurate. The flight registration tool is limited in options and can be pricey.
    • Alternatives: Yelp, Google Maps, Foursquare, Zomato.

    Google Maps

    • Functionality: It is a navigator which provides directions, traffic updates, and local business info worldwide. The software also allows people to search for hotels, restaurants, hospitals, and other places and save them to a personalized map. 
    • Pros: Google Maps provide accurate and real-time navigation and transit info. It allows easy customization and integration with other Google services. 
    • Cons: Your phone’s battery and data can get swiftly drained, and some locations may have very limited info. Users can also have privacy concerns with its location tracking feature.
    • Alternatives: Waze, Apple Maps, MapQuest, Here We Go.

    Skyscanner

    • Functionality: Skyscanner is a flight booking app that allows users to search for flights, compare prices, and book tickets directly from the page. It also offers hotel and car rental search options.
    • Pros: Skyscanner provides a comprehensive search for flights, with flexible date and destination choices. It offers a price alert feature and an “Everywhere” search preference for finding the cheapest flights.
    • Cons: The app can be slow and confusing with its many filtering choices. Some flight booking options may have hidden fees or restrictions.
    • Alternatives: Expedia, Kayak, Hopper, Momondo.

    Rome2rio

    • Functionality: Rome2rio is a travel planner that provides transportation choices and itineraries worldwide, including flights, trains, buses, and ferries. It also offers estimated journey times and costs.
    • Pros: Rome2rio provides comprehensive and multi-modal riding options, making it easy to plan complex journeys. It provides detailed information on transportation routes, including timetables and fares.
    • Cons: The app may not always have the most up-to-date information, and some routes may not be available in certain regions. The booking feature redirects users to external websites.
    • Alternatives: GoEuro, Omio, Transit, Moovit.

    TripIt

    • Functionality: TripIt is a travel organization app that helps people manage their itineraries, organizing, and journey plans in one place. Users can forward their confirmation emails to the page, and it automatically creates a detailed itinerary.
    • Pros: TripIt offers a seamless and organized way to manage travel plans, including flights, accommodations, and activities. It provides real-time flight alerts and syncs with calendars.
    • Cons: The free version of TripIt has limited features, and some people may find it overwhelming with its information overload. The app requires access to personal email accounts for itinerary creation.
    • Alternatives: TripCase, Kayak, Google Trips, Apple Wallet.

    XE Currency

    • Functionality: XE Currency is a currency conversion app that provides up-to-date exchange rates and allows users to convert currencies easily. It works offline and gives historical currency charts.
    • Pros: XE Currency offers accurate and real-time currency conversion with a user-friendly interface. It allows for customization with favorite currencies and provides notifications for rate changes.
    • Cons: It may display ads, and some have reported occasional glitches with rate updates. The historical currency charts are limited in functionality.
    • Alternatives: OANDA Currency Converter, Currency Converter Plus, CoinCalc.

    Google Translate

    • Functionality: It is a language translation application that supports translation between over 100 languages. It allows users to translate texts, voice, and images, and it works offline as well for some languages. 
    • Pros: This software provides quick and accurate translations, and it has a user-friendly interface. It offers some additional features like conversation mode and offline translation as well. 
    • Cons: The interpretation may not always be perfect, especially with complex sentences or idiomatic expressions. Also, the offline feature is limited to a selected number of languages. 
    • Alternatives: Microsoft translator, iTranslate, SayHi, TripLingo.

    Uber

    • Functionality: Uber is a ride-sharing app that allows users to request a private car service with a few taps. It provides estimated fares, driver information, and real-time tracking of the ride.
    • Pros: Uber offers various options for safe, dependable transportation in many cities worldwide. The app provides cashless payments, driver ratings, and an easy-to-use interface.
    • Cons: Uber may have limited availability in some regions or during certain hours. Surge pricing during peak times can lead to higher fares, and some consumers have reported safety concerns.
    • Alternatives: Lyft, Grab, DiDi, Ola.
